Accepted risks
Findings the reviewer chose to accept rather than block on.
| Source | Rule | Reason | Accepted by | When |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| semgrep | semgrep:child-process-import | AI (semgrep): swarm-js is a Swarm daemon client that legitimately needs child_process to spawn and manage the Swarm binary. This is core to the package's documented functionality. | ai | |
| phantom-deps | phantom-dep:buffer | AI (phantom-deps): buffer is a browser polyfill declared for browserify/webpack bundling; package has both main and browser entry points, making this a standard isomorphic pattern. | ai | |
| phantom-deps | phantom-dep:setimmediate | AI (phantom-deps): setimmediate is a browser polyfill declared for bundler config; consistent with the package's isomorphic (Node + browser) design. | ai |
